How does the Batman and Poison Ivy romance develop in fanfiction?

Often, the development begins with a mutual fascination. Batman is intrigued by Poison Ivy's powers and her unwavering beliefs, while Ivy is drawn to Batman's strength and mystery. As the story progresses in fanfiction, they might have shared adventures. For instance, they could be forced to work together to stop a villain who is harming both the city and nature. During these adventures, their feelings grow as they rely on each other and see the good in one another. It's a slow - burn process where they gradually let down their guards and fall in love.

Well, in a lot of fanfiction, the development of their romance is complex. At first, they are at odds with each other. Batman sees Ivy as a criminal due to her illegal activities in the name of nature. But then, things start to change. Ivy might show Batman the beauty and importance of nature in a new light, and Batman might show Ivy that there are other ways to achieve her goals. Their relationship evolves as they start to communicate more, have deep conversations about their values, and eventually, their initial animosity turns into love.

In some fanfiction, it starts with a chance encounter. Maybe Batman is investigating a crime related to Ivy's plants, and he sees a different side of her. This initial meeting plants the seed (no pun intended) for their relationship. Then, as they interact more, they start to understand each other's motives better. For example, Batman realizes that Ivy's actions, although extreme at times, are rooted in her love for nature.
